Network Traffic Inspection

Network traffic inspection is the process of analyzing data packets as they travel across a computer network. This analysis helps identify malicious activity, unauthorized access attempts, and policy breaches. It involves examining packet headers and payloads to understand communication patterns and content. This proactive approach is vital for maintaining network security and operational integrity.

Understanding Network Traffic Inspection

Network traffic inspection is implemented using various tools like Intrusion Detection Systems IDS, Intrusion Prevention Systems IPS, and firewalls. These tools monitor incoming and outgoing data, looking for signatures of known attacks, unusual behavior, or compliance violations. For instance, an IPS might block traffic containing malware, while an IDS alerts administrators to suspicious port scans. Deep Packet Inspection DPI goes further by examining the actual content of data packets, not just headers, to identify sophisticated threats or ensure data loss prevention. This proactive monitoring helps organizations defend against cyberattacks and maintain network health.

Effective network traffic inspection is a core responsibility for IT and security teams. It forms a critical part of an organization's overall cybersecurity governance framework. By continuously monitoring traffic, organizations can significantly reduce their exposure to cyber risks, including data breaches and system compromises. Strategically, it provides valuable insights into network usage, potential vulnerabilities, and compliance with regulatory requirements. This proactive security measure is essential for protecting sensitive information and ensuring business continuity.

How Network Traffic Inspection Processes Identity, Context, and Access Decisions

Network traffic inspection involves monitoring data packets as they travel across a network. Specialized tools capture these packets and analyze their headers and payloads. This analysis checks for known threats, policy violations, and unusual patterns. Techniques include deep packet inspection DPI, which examines packet content, and stateful inspection, which tracks connection states. Firewalls, intrusion detection systems IDS, and intrusion prevention systems IPS commonly perform these inspections to identify and block malicious activity or unauthorized data flows. The goal is to gain visibility into network communications and enforce security policies in real time.

The lifecycle of network traffic inspection involves continuous monitoring, alert generation, and incident response. Governance includes defining inspection policies, regularly updating threat intelligence, and auditing system performance. These tools integrate with security information and event management SIEM systems for centralized logging and correlation. They also work with endpoint detection and response EDR solutions to provide a holistic view of threats. Regular policy reviews and system tuning are crucial to adapt to evolving threats and maintain effective security posture.

Places Network Traffic Inspection Is Commonly Used

Network traffic inspection is essential for identifying and mitigating various cyber threats across an organization's digital infrastructure.

  • Detecting malware and ransomware by identifying suspicious file transfers or command-and-control communications.
  • Preventing data exfiltration by monitoring for unauthorized attempts to send sensitive information outside the network.
  • Enforcing compliance policies by ensuring network traffic adheres to regulatory requirements and internal security standards.
  • Identifying insider threats through unusual access patterns or communication with unauthorized external hosts.
  • Troubleshooting network performance issues by analyzing traffic bottlenecks and application-specific communication problems.

The Biggest Takeaways of Network Traffic Inspection

  • Implement both perimeter and internal network traffic inspection to detect threats moving laterally.
  • Regularly update threat intelligence feeds to ensure inspection tools can identify the latest attack signatures.
  • Integrate inspection data with SIEM and EDR platforms for comprehensive threat visibility and faster response.
  • Tune inspection policies frequently to reduce false positives and adapt to changes in network behavior and applications.

What We Often Get Wrong

Encryption Makes Inspection Impossible

While encryption hides data content, traffic inspection can still analyze metadata like source, destination, and packet size. Decryption at the perimeter or within a proxy allows full inspection of encrypted traffic before re-encryption, which is crucial for comprehensive threat detection.

Firewalls Are Sufficient for Inspection

Traditional firewalls primarily control access based on rules. Advanced traffic inspection goes deeper, analyzing packet payloads and behavioral patterns for threats that bypass basic firewall rules. Relying solely on firewalls leaves significant security gaps.

Inspection Only Slows Down the Network

Modern inspection tools are highly optimized and designed for minimal performance impact. While some overhead exists, the security benefits of detecting advanced threats far outweigh minor latency. Proper sizing and deployment are key to efficiency.

On this page

Frequently Asked Questions

What is network traffic inspection?

Network traffic inspection involves monitoring and analyzing data packets as they travel across a network. This process examines the content, source, destination, and protocols of network communications. Its primary goal is to identify suspicious activities, security threats, and policy violations. By scrutinizing traffic patterns and data payloads, organizations can gain visibility into their network's health and security posture. It is a fundamental practice for maintaining network integrity.

Why is network traffic inspection important for cybersecurity?

Network traffic inspection is crucial for cybersecurity because it provides real-time visibility into network activity. This allows security teams to detect and respond to threats like malware, unauthorized access, and data exfiltration promptly. Without it, malicious activities could go unnoticed, leading to significant breaches. It helps enforce security policies, identify vulnerabilities, and ensure compliance with regulatory requirements, safeguarding sensitive information and critical systems.

What are common tools or methods used for network traffic inspection?

Common tools for network traffic inspection include Intrusion Detection Systems (IDS) and Intrusion Prevention Systems (IPS), which monitor for known attack signatures. Deep Packet Inspection (DPI) examines packet payloads for more granular analysis. Network Flow Analysis tools, like NetFlow or IPFIX, analyze metadata about traffic flows rather than content. Security Information and Event Management (SIEM) systems aggregate and analyze logs from various sources, including network devices, to provide a comprehensive view.

How does network traffic inspection help detect threats?

Network traffic inspection detects threats by looking for anomalies, known attack signatures, and policy violations within data flows. For example, it can identify unusual outbound connections, attempts to access restricted resources, or the presence of malicious code in packet payloads. By comparing current traffic against baseline behavior or threat intelligence, security analysts can pinpoint suspicious activities. This proactive monitoring enables early detection and mitigation of potential cyberattacks before they cause significant damage.